    Can't confirm any of this but it is being reported that the update dropped:

    * Added tameable wolves
    * Added cookies
    * Sleeping in a bed now resets your spawn position
    * New Minecraft logo
    * Holding shift while climbing will hang on to the ladder
    * Spiders will no longer trample crops
    * Lots and lots of infrastructure for Statistics lists and Achievements

    Wolves:

    They are said to be rather rare, but they will not despawn once tamed. To tame a wolf, you have to give it bones until a puff of heart particles appears and it gains a red collar, which indicates that the wolf has been tamed. The number of bones required is random. You can tame more than one wolf.

    Once given enough bones, they will become friendly. They will now protect you, follow you around, and will attack mobs that you have attacked in melee. Tamed wolves will not attack mobs that you hit with arrows, nor will they attack creepers. Wolves will also not attack mobs if they are sitting. In their current developmental state, mobs will not attack your wolves (Subject to change). A wolf's tail will rise and lower depending on its health, and it can be restored with raw pork (and possibly other foods). They will be unable to climb ladders, but will teleport to you if you create a large distance between yourself and them as long as they are not sitting.
